Barbados Religion: Anglican - St.James Parish Church

St.James Parish ChurchLocation : Holetown, St.James

Date Built : 1847

Historical Facts
St.James Parish Church is among the four oldest surviving churches in Barbados and is located near the site of the island's first settlement in Holetown. In the southern porch of the church is a bell with the inscription - "God bless King William, 1696". This bell pre-dates the famous American Liberty bell by 54 years.

Main Features : mural tablets, stained glass windows.
